Natick Center Walking Tour

Walk Natick Center with local historian Terri Evans and learn how the railroad and the shoe industry transformed 19th-century Natick. Hear stories from the 1874 fire and discover how arts and culture inspire the “heart of Natick” today.

This postcard view of Natick Center looking South towards the Common dates to 1908. (NHS Collections)
